The UCCS College of Business is one of eight original participating schools in the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.danielsfund.org\/ethics\/collegiate\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Daniels Fund Ethics Initiative Collegiate Program<\/a>\u202fthat now includes twelve participating schools. The DFEI supports the Southern Colorado Education Consortium (SCEC) for nine higher education institutions in the southern half of the state. In 2016, the DFEI Collegiate Program at UCCS launched an ethics champion pilot program to expand best practices in ethics education. Each participating school has educators serving as Ethics Champions on their campus to expand principle-based ethics education and resources throughout southern Colorado.
